8-K: Syra Health Appoints Gregory Alexander as CEO

CEO Appointment


Syra Health Corp. announced the appointment of Gregory R. Alexander, a seasoned healthcare executive and former U.S. Marine, as its new Chief Executive Officer, effective January 5, 2026.

Summary

  • Gregory R. Alexander has been appointed Chief Executive Officer of Syra Health Corp., with his employment effective January 5, 2026.
  • His annual base salary is set at $251,000.
  • He is eligible for an annual performance bonus with a target amount equal to 30% of his annual base salary, with actual payouts potentially ranging from 0% to 50% based on company and individual performance milestones.
  • Mr. Alexander will be granted 110,537 restricted stock units (RSUs), with 20% vesting one year after the grant date and the remainder vesting equally over the subsequent four years.
  • He will also receive stock options to purchase 257,920 shares of Class B common stock, with 20% vesting on December 31, 2026, and the remainder vesting equally on an annual basis through December 31, 2030.
  • Additionally, 368,458 performance stock units (PSUs) will be granted, subject to the achievement of performance targets related to revenue growth, profitability, and strategic milestones determined by the Board of Directors.
  • The employment agreement includes non-competition and non-solicitation provisions for one year following the termination of his employment.
  • Detailed severance provisions are outlined for various termination scenarios, including enhanced benefits if termination occurs in the context of a change of control.

Comparison to Industry Standards

  • Alexander's experience at Ellipsis Health (voice AI), CitizensRx ($500M PBM, tripled sales), and Lumeris ($1.5B population health, 20%+ annual Medicare Advantage growth) demonstrates a track record comparable to high-performing executives in the healthcare technology and managed care sectors.
  • His leadership in expanding operations from three to eleven markets at Lumeris and supporting Indiana University Health Systems' $600 million health plan with 185,000 members indicates a capacity for large-scale operational management and market penetration, which is a strong asset in the competitive healthcare industry.
